你查询的IP:[210.82.130.126]  地理位置:中国–北京–北京

最新查询116.194.192.65 119.19.129.109 123.56.117.241 58.192.128.157 119.69.202.124 119.254.178.12 117.44.103.241 59.32.177.136 119.19.107.128 210.82.130.126 60.255.250.28 116.204.192.43 202.164.55.140 203.92.160.116 120.30.255.38 118.120.180.223 203.89.92.238 203.175.192.93 118.72.202.171 122.160.64.252 125.254.128.103 210.32.102.123 120.92.181.191 202.127.40.64 122.102.64.205 203.130.32.178 125.216.41.107 222.126.128.98 219.72.233.214 210.79.224.229 202.122.32.222